2 bedroom Mid Terrace Bungalow for sale, Nethertown, Egremont, Cumbria, CA22
Features and Description
Situated in an idyllic beachfront location, this exceptional two-bedroom bungalow presents a rare opportunity to acquire a home in an enviable coastal setting. Nestled in a peaceful and rural position, the property enjoys breath taking, uninterrupted sea views, with the Isle of Man visible on clear days.
Beautifully maintained throughout and thoughtfully designed to make the very most of its spectacular surroundings, the accommodation is light, airy and immaculately presented. The property briefly comprises a welcoming entrance hall, a stylish modern kitchen/dining room, a bright and spacious living room, and a versatile conservatory where you can sit back and enjoy the ever-changing coastal scenery. There are also two well-proportioned bedrooms and a contemporary family bathroom.
Externally, the property boasts a superb decked terrace, creating the perfect space for al fresco dining, entertaining family and friends, or simply relaxing whilst soaking up the stunning panoramic views. With the beach on your doorstep and an abundance of scenic walks right from the property, this truly is a lifestyle opportunity unlike any other.
Whether you’re searching for a tranquil permanent residence by the sea, a peaceful holiday retreat, or an investment with excellent holiday letting potential, this delightful bungalow offers endless possibilities in an unforgettable setting.

Entry
Welcoming entrance to the home, with the added convenience of a fitted storage cupboard and plumbing for a washing machine- ideal as a laundry room.
Kitchen / Dining Room
13'3" x 10'10" (4.04m x 3.30m)
Modern kitchen/dining room, offering a range of fitted units, with dark oak effect countertop, feature tiled backsplash and free standing gas cooker- powered by LPG gas canisters. A fitted breakfast bar provides a fantastic dining space, with an integral cupboard providing additional storage space.
Living Room
15'10" x 11'7" (4.82m x 3.52m)
Connected to the kitchen by double doors, creating an effortless flow between the living spaces. The living room boasts vaulted ceilings with exposed beams and a feature multi-fuel stove with tiled surround- allowing for a light and airy feel without compromising on the cosy atmosphere. Windows and connecting door to the conservatory continue flood the room with natural light, and take full advantage of the stunning sea views.
Conservatory
9'11" x 9'9" (3.03m x 2.96m)
Constructed by the current owners, the conservatory provides a versatile, additional reception room- ideal as a formal dining area or second living room- to sit and fully appreciate the truly special coastal views. Double doors lead out to the terrace.
Bedroom 1
11'11" x 7'9" (3.63m x 2.36m)
Cosy double bedroom, also boasting sea views.
Hallway
Connecting the kitchen to the second bedroom and bathroom, benefitting from a variety of fitted cupboards, providing fantastic storage space.
Bedroom 2
Ideal guest bedroom, with skylight.
Bathroom
6'11" x 5'7" (2.10m x 1.70m)
Modern bathroom, with contemporary tiling. Comprising a bath with shower over, WC and wash hand basin set within a fitted vanity unit.
Terrace
To the rear of the property is the decked terrace. Ideal for outdoor entertaining and dining, the terrace provides a private space to fully appreciate the unique location of this home, enjoying the sea views and on a clear day- views of the Isle of Man. A shed also provides storage space.
Agents Notes
We have been informed by the current owners that the property is of breeze block construction (unverified), to the external walls. However, we understand that the neighbouring properties on either side are of non-standard construction.Given the property’s coastal location and proximity to the sea, prospective purchasers intending to buy with the assistance of a mortgage are advised to satisfy themselves that the property meets the lending criteria of their chosen mortgage provider.The property is fitted with electric heating, with the multi-fuel stove providing the hot water supply. It also benefits from double glazing.Drainage is via a shared septic tank, which serves three properties and is situated within the boundary of the adjoining property to the right-hand side. We have been advised that the septic tank was last emptied in May 2026, with the associated maintenance costs shared equally between the three properties it serves. We are unable to confirm whether the septic tank complies with current regulations, and prospective purchasers are advised to make their own enquiries through their legal representative prior to exchange of contracts.Parking for the property is on-street where available.For further information or to discuss any of the above, please contact the branch.
